HR Service Center Manager
Essential Skills and q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ree (B.A. or B.S.) in Human Resources, Business or relevant field of study and 4+ years of experience.
- Experience leading a HR Shared Service or Business Service Operations team.
- Past role supporting US and Canada.
- Knowledge of European and Asia Pacific business practices a plus.
- PHR/SPHR and/or CEBS coursework is beneficial.
- Efficient with Microsoft Office including Excel, Word, PowerPoint and OneNote and web-based applications. PeopleSoft and Fusion experience are beneficial.
- Proven ability to manage and motivate a team.
- Experience of developing key metrics to enhance service delivery.
- Adapts quickly to changes impacting both technical and non-technical processes, policies and procedures. Effectively participates in change management initiatives.
- Experience leading process optimization and migration projects.
- Comfort managing up and across the organization, with strong credibility and the ability to influence leaders and teams, excellent collaboration and organization skills.
- Ability to work with minimal guidance/direction, serves as escalation point and decision maker on exception requests.
- Must be able to exercise judgment and independently determine and take appropriate action within defined HR policies and procedures.
- Excellent ver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skills are required. Must possess effective influencing, conflict management and resolution skills
